How Much to Add Apple Watch to T-Mobile Plan: A Complete Guide

Adding an Apple Watch with cellular capabilities to your existing T-Mobile plan typically involves a monthly service fee and potentially a one-time activation fee. The exact cost can vary slightly based on current promotions and whether you're adding it as a new line or transferring an existing one.

Understanding T-Mobile's Apple Watch Plans

T-Mobile generally offers specific plans designed for wearable devices like the Apple Watch. These plans usually fall under their "Smartwatch Data Plans" or similar categories.

The most common plan for an Apple Watch on T-Mobile is usually around $10-$15 per month. This typically includes:

  • Unlimited talk and text from your Apple Watch.

  • Unlimited high-speed data specifically for your Apple Watch.

Important Note: This monthly fee is in addition to your existing T-Mobile phone plan. Also, be aware of potential taxes and fees that may apply, which can vary by location. There's also usually a $35 device connection charge when activating a new line, though this is sometimes waived for online activations.

Step 1: Do You Have a Compatible Apple Watch and iPhone? Let's Find Out!

Before anything else, let's make sure you have the right equipment. This is crucial! You can't just connect any Apple Watch to a cellular plan.

  • Your Apple Watch must be a GPS + Cellular model. Standard GPS-only Apple Watch models do not have the hardware to connect to a cellular network. You'll typically see "GPS + Cellular" in the watch's description or on its packaging.

  • You need a compatible iPhone. For most recent Apple Watch models (Series 8, 9, Ultra 2, etc.), you'll need an iPhone 8 or later running the latest version of iOS (currently iOS 16 or later is often required). You can check your iPhone model by going to Settings > General > About. To update your iOS, go to Settings > General > Software Update.

  • Your iPhone and Apple Watch must use the same network provider. In this case, both your iPhone and Apple Watch will be on T-Mobile.

If you're unsure about your Apple Watch model, check the back of the watch or its original box for details. If it doesn't explicitly say "GPS + Cellular," it likely won't work with a cellular plan.

Step 3: Activating Cellular on Your Apple Watch

This is where the magic happens! The process is primarily done through the Apple Watch app on your iPhone.

Sub-heading: Open the Apple Watch App

  • On your iPhone, locate and open the "Watch" app. This is the central hub for managing your Apple Watch.

Sub-heading: Navigate to Cellular Settings

  • Within the Watch app, tap on the "My Watch" tab at the bottom.

  • Scroll down and tap on "Cellular".

Sub-heading: Initiate Cellular Setup

  • You should see an option to "Set Up Cellular" or "Add a New Plan." Tap on this.

  • T-Mobile's system will now guide you through the activation process. This will involve verifying your T-Mobile account. You might need to log in with your T-Mobile ID and password.

  • Follow the on-screen prompts. T-Mobile will typically confirm the monthly cost for the Apple Watch line.

  • Review the service agreement carefully and then "Accept" to proceed.

Sub-heading: Confirmation and Activation

  • Once you accept the terms, T-Mobile will begin activating the eSIM profile on your Apple Watch. This can take a few minutes.

  • You'll usually receive a confirmation message on your iPhone and/or Apple Watch once the cellular plan is active. The Cellular icon in your Apple Watch's Control Center (swipe up from the watch face) should turn green, indicating a cellular connection.

Step 4: Verifying Your Connection and Usage

After activation, it's good to double-check that everything is working as expected.

Sub-heading: Check Cellular Signal on Your Watch

  • Swipe up from the watch face to open Control Center.

  • Look for the Cellular button (it looks like an antenna). When your Apple Watch is connected to a cellular network (and not near your iPhone or Wi-Fi), this button will turn green, and you'll see green signal bars indicating the strength of the connection.

Sub-heading: Make a Test Call or Send a Text

  • To confirm calls and texts are working: Try making a call or sending a text message from your Apple Watch while your iPhone is out of range or turned off. This will verify that your Apple Watch is truly operating independently on the T-Mobile network.

Sub-heading: Monitor Data Usage

  • To check your cellular data usage on your Apple Watch:

    • Open the Watch app on your iPhone.

    • Tap the My Watch tab, then tap Cellular.

    • Scroll down to the "Cellular Data Usage" section.

How to check if my Apple Watch is cellular compatible?

Look for "GPS + Cellular" in the watch's name or specifications, usually found on the box, Apple's website, or the Apple Watch app under "My Watch" > "General" > "About."

How to activate cellular on my Apple Watch if I didn't do it during initial setup?

Open the Apple Watch app on your iPhone, go to the "My Watch" tab, tap "Cellular," and then select "Set Up Cellular" or "Add a New Plan."

How to know if my Apple Watch is using cellular data?

Swipe up from the watch face to open Control Center; the Cellular icon will be green when connected to the cellular network, showing signal bars.

How to switch between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and Cellular on Apple Watch?

Your Apple Watch automatically switches to the most power-efficient connection. It prioritizes iPhone connection (Bluetooth), then known Wi-Fi, then cellular. You can manually turn cellular on/off in Control Center.

How to use my Apple Watch for calls and texts without my iPhone?

Once cellular is activated, your Apple Watch can make and receive calls and texts using its cellular connection, even if your iPhone is off or far away.

How to check my monthly cost for the Apple Watch line on T-Mobile?

You can view your monthly bill or log into your T-Mobile account online or through the T-Mobile app to see the line item charge for your Apple Watch. It's typically around $10-$15/month plus taxes/fees.

How to get a new Apple Watch with T-Mobile?

You can purchase a GPS + Cellular Apple Watch directly from T-Mobile, often with financing options and special promotions, and they will guide you through adding it to your plan.

How to transfer my Apple Watch cellular plan to a new Apple Watch?

Within the Apple Watch app on your iPhone, you can usually remove the cellular plan from your old watch and then during the setup of your new watch, choose to set up cellular and transfer your existing plan.

How to disable cellular on my Apple Watch temporarily?

Swipe up from the watch face to open Control Center, then tap the Cellular icon to toggle it off. This can help save battery life.

How to set up an Apple Watch for a family member on T-Mobile?

T-Mobile supports "Family Setup," allowing you to set up an Apple Watch for a family member who doesn't have their own iPhone. This is done through the Apple Watch app on your iPhone, and you'll choose "Set Up for a Family Member" during the pairing process.
